On Friday 02 January 2009 18:03, Sander Marechal wrote: > Nigel Henry wrote: > > I'd suggest adding a couple of extra options lines to > > /etc/modprobe.d/sound, as below, reboot, and see how that goes. > > > > options snd-hda-intel index=1 > > options snd-mpu401 index=2 > > > > The snd-mpu401 is for the games/midi connection on your soundcard > > The snd-hda-intel looks like it's for some sound component on the > > graphics card, probably HDMI. > > Worked like a charm.
